Our verdict is Pathogenic. Variant got 11 ACMG points: 11P and 0B. PM1PM2PM5PP3_StrongPP5

The NM_000551.4(VHL):c.575C>T(p.Pro192Leu) variant causes a missense change. The variant was absent in control chromosomes in GnomAD project. In-silico tool predicts a pathogenic out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Conflicting classifications of pathogenicity (no stars). Another variant affecting the same amino acid position, but resulting in a different missense (i.e. P192R) has been classified as Likely pathogenic.

Genes affected
VHL (HGNC:12687): (von Hippel-Lindau tumor suppressor) This gene encodes a component of a ubiquitination complex. The encoded protein is involved in the ubiquitination and degradation of hypoxia-inducible-factor (HIF), which is a transcription factor that plays a central role in the regulation of gene expression by oxygen. In addition to oxygen-related gene expression, this protein plays a role in many other cellular processes including cilia formation, cytokine signaling, regulation of senescence, and formation of the extracellular matrix. Variants of this gene are associated with von Hippel-Lindau syndrome, pheochromocytoma, erythrocytosis, renal cell carcinoma, and cerebellar hemangioblastoma. [provided by RefSeq, Jun 2022]

Uncertain significance,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ingKCCC/NGS Laboratory, Kuwait Cancer Control CenterJul 07, 2023This sequence change replaces proline with leucine at codon 192 of the VHL protein (p.Pro192Leu). The proline residue is highly conserved and there is a moderate physicochemical difference between proline and leucine. This variant is not present in population databases gnomAD. This variant has not been reported in the literature in individuals with VHL-related disease. This variant lies in a region which is length 17 amino-acids long and is considered as a dense hot-spot. In-silico predictions show pathogenic computational verdict based on 11 pathogenic predictions from BayesDel_addAF, DANN, DEOGEN2, EIGEN, FATHMM-MKL, LIST-S2, M-CAP, MVP, MutationAssessor, MutationTaster and SIFT vs 1 benign prediction from PrimateAI. However, these predictions have not been confirmed by published functional studies and their clinical significance is uncertain. Therefore, it has been classified as a Variant of Uncertain Significance. -

P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ingInvitaeApr 23, 2023This sequence change replaces proline, which is neutral and non-polar, with leucine, which is neutral and non-polar, at codon 192 of the VHL protein (p.Pro192Leu). For these reasons, this variant has been classified as Pathogenic. This variant disrupts the p.Pro192 amino acid residue in VHL. Other variant(s) that disrupt this residue have been observed in individuals with VHL-related conditions (Invitae), which suggests that this may be a clinically significant amino acid residue. Advanced modeling of protein sequence and biophysical properties (such as structural, functional, and spatial information, amino acid conservation, physicochemical variation, residue mobility, and thermodynamic stability) performed at Invitae indicates that this missense variant is expected to disrupt VHL protein function. ClinVar contains an entry for this variant (Variation ID: 526677). This missense change has been observed in individual(s) with clinical features of von Hippel-Lindau syndrome (Invitae). It has also been observed to segregate with disease in related individuals. This variant is not present in population databases (gnomAD no frequency). -

Likely p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ingAmbry GeneticsApr 26, 2021The p.P192L variant (also known as c.575C>T), located in coding exon 3 of the VHL gene, results from a C to T substitution at nucleotide position 575. The proline at codon 192 is replaced by leucine, an amino acid with similar properties. In one study, this alteration was identified 2/625 patients with bilateral pheochromocytomas (Neumann HPH et al. JAMA Netw Open, 2019 08;2:e198898). This amino acid position is highly conserved in available vertebrate species. In addition, this alteration is predicted to be deleterious by in silico analysis. Based on the majority of available evidence to date, this variant is likely to be pathogenic. -
